Job Description

The Director of Process Improvement leads efforts to enhance business processes and operational efficiencies across the organization, collaborating with various teams to establish a culture of process documentation and continuous improvement. This role involves managing process improvement initiatives, developing training programs, and utilizing methodologies like Lean Six Sigma to drive measurable enhancements in performance.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ead enterprise efforts to develop and improve business processes and practices.
  • Collaborate with leaders and cross-functional teams to increase operational efficiencies.
  • Develop and manage documentation templates and standards for business process management.
  • Evaluate existing processes and workflows for opportunities to enhance efficiency and quality.
  • Define KPIs to measure the success of improvement initiatives.
  • Develop and curate training materials to enhance organizational capabilities.
  • Train, coach, and mentor Green Belts and project sponsors.
  • Create an enterprise business process repository and assist with implementation.
  • Establish a Green Belt program improvement community.
  • Lead efforts to incorporate continuous improvement methodologies into the culture.
  • Quantify the business impact of process improvement initiatives through metrics.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Operations Management, Business Administration, or related field OR equivalent work experience.
  • 7 years of experience in process improvement, change management, or quality improvement business transformations.
  • 5 years of experience leading process improvement initiatives.
  • Black Belt certification in Lean Six Sigma or equivalent required.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with a track record of driving measurable improvements in operational performance.
  • Expert-level knowledge of relevant software tools and technologies for process mapping, data analysis, and performance tracking.
  • Ability to lift and move objects up to 10 pounds frequently and up to 25 pounds occasionally.
  • Regular responsibilities include speaking, listening, standing, walking, using hands for handling or feeling, and reaching with arms.
